ループを使用してオブジェクトに動的に値を追加する方法。ループを使用してオブジェクトに動的に値を追加する方法
var object = [
{lat: 1, lng: 2},
{lat: 3, lng: 4},
{lat: 5, lng: 6},
];
ループを使用してオブジェクトに動的に値を追加する方法。ループを使用してオブジェクトに動的に値を追加する方法
var object = [
{lat: 1, lng: 2},
{lat: 3, lng: 4},
{lat: 5, lng: 6},
];
for (var i=0;i<10;i++){
object.push({lat:4,lng:7});
}
あなたは何を意味するか、このですか?
var object = [
{lat: 1, lng: 2},
{lat: 3, lng: 4},
{lat: 5, lng: 6},
];
document.write("<br/>Object before:"+JSON.stringify(object));
for (var i=0;i<10;i++){
object.push({lat:4,lng:7});
}
document.write("<br/><br/>Object after:"+JSON.stringify(object));
ブラケットを適用する必要はありませんか? –
正しいですか? \t varオブジェクト。 for(var i = 0; i <10; i ++){ object.push [{lat:4、lng:7}]; } –
あなたのサンプルには、オブジェクトの配列である変数 "object"が含まれています。配列には配列の最後に他のオブジェクトを追加できるpush()メソッドがあります。それを呼び出す正しい方法は、私がすでにobject.push(...)ではなくobject.push [...]を指摘しているからです –
何を、どこで追加? –
オブジェクトに新しい値を追加しています。結果varオブジェクト= [ {lat:1、lng:2}、 {lat:3、lng:4}、 {lat:5、lng:6}、{lat:7、lng:8}、 ] ; ' –
最初にオブジェクトを持っていない、オブジェクトを含む配列があります。 – epascarello